Not sure how to word this exactly but wanted to warn anyone shopping from UK or in general the EU:

avoid this site: guitarengineeringltd.com

Its a shame that in the EU we have limited resources for amp parts + guitar parts, but stick to known good ones (like tube-town..).
guitarengineeringltd used to be known as Arranz Guitars in Spain. Search google about arranz and you'll see what it was like - I lost quite some money on an order from them :/

guitarengineeringltd has been around for a few months and bad reviews are starting to pop up :/ (they just deleted their facebook page recently, I went on there and saw many poor souls asking "where is my order") ... so just wanted to try and help anyone else avoid the headache and just stay away - buy elsewhere
